520 8 _a'Accessibility and the Bus System' explores the role of the bus system in enabling cities to function sustainably and efficiently by providing the necessary resources to support growing populations. The book takes a comprehensive view of what buses can and cannot do, and how to maximise the bus system's positive contribution while minimising the negative impacts.--
